Kinds Of Paint Finishes



When it involves paint coatings, there are 5 main kinds you must learn about: flat,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ss. Each kind serves a particular objective and can substantially impact the look of your area.

Level coatings have a matte appearance, making them fantastic for concealing flaws on walls. They're ideal for ceilings or low-traffic areas yet can be challenging to clean.

Eggshell finishes offer a minor sheen, providing more toughness while still being forgiving on blemishes. They're excellent for living areas or bedrooms.

Satin finishes are preferred for their soft luster, making them functional for different applications, including kitchens and bathrooms. They're easier to tidy than flat or eggshell finishes, making them sensible for high-traffic locations.

Semi-gloss coatings offer a visible shine, which works well for trim, moldings, and cupboards. They're highly long lasting and very easy to wipe down, ideal for rooms susceptible to dampness.

Lastly, gloss finishes have a reflective, shiny surface area, making them ideal for accent pieces or furniture.

Comprehending these sorts of paint coatings will aid you make educated decisions for your following paint project.

Choosing the Right Complete



Selecting the right paint surface can be a video game changer in your house's visual and performance. To make the most effective choice, think about the space's objective and the degree of toughness you need.

For high-traffic locations like corridors or kitchens, select a satin or semi-gloss surface; these are extra resistant to discolorations and easy to tidy.

If you're repainting a bedroom or a living room, a flat or eggshell surface may be the method to go. These coatings offer a softer look and can conceal blemishes well, producing a comfy atmosphere.

Do not ignore lighting, either. Shiny finishes can mirror light, making a small area really feel bigger, while matte finishes absorb light, adding heat.

Finally, consider upkeep. Shiny surfaces require more routine upkeep to keep their shine, while matte surfaces might need touch-ups more often because of scuffs.
